So fügen Sie RDFa in die Produktbewertung hinzu

Wenn Sie jemals google suchen und fragte sich, “wie setzen Sie diese Sterne in die Suchergebnisse?” Dann willst du wissen was RDFa ist und wie es funktioniert

Der Schwerpunkt dieser Post ist nicht, die RDFa zu präsentieren, sondern ihre praktische Anwendung in Magento. In diesem Artikel werden wir genauer über die Verwendung von RDF in der Produktbewertung sprechen. Das wird so ein organisches Suchergebnis generieren:

RDFa Bewertung Magento

Haben Sie Ihre Aufmerksamkeit!?

Schnelle Einführung

Ich muss schnell erklären, was wir als nächstes tun werden, also sieht es nicht aus wie aus dieser Welt.

RDFa ist ein Text-Markup, genau wie HTML ist. Also, was wir tun werden, ist ganz einfach… einfach den Text mit den entsprechenden Tags markieren. Um mehr über RDFa zu erfahren, gehen Sie zu:

https://support.google.com/webmasters/answer/146898?hl=de-DE

Es wäre sehr sinnvoll, wenn das Magento-Entwicklerteam dieses RDF-Markup schon nativ in den Themen erstellt hat, aber leider ist das bisher nicht vorhanden. Also müssen wir die folgenden Schritte unternehmen.

RDFa Produktbewertung markup

Es gibt verschiedene Arten von RDFa-Content-Markierungen, in diesem Moment werden wir sehen, wie man RDFa-Markierung verwendet, um die Auswertung unserer Produkte in organischen Suchergebnissen anzuzeigen.

Um zu beginnen, bearbeiten wir die summary.phtml Datei, die sich befindet bei:

app > design > frontend > base > default > template > review > helper > summary.phtml

Ändern Sie keine Dateien in base/default, erstellen Sie eine Kopie dieser Datei auf default/default in benutzerdefiniertes Paket/Thema und wenden Sie Änderungen an der Kopie an.

Am Anfang der Datei, in class=”ratings” add:

Jetzt füge einfach die Informationskarte direkt unter die Bewertung class=”rating” ein.

escapeHtml($this->getProduct()->getName()) ?>

    
        getRatingSummary() ?>
        100
    

Speichern Sie einfach die Datei und fertig.

Ich will mehr wissen

Sie wollen wahrscheinlich wissen, ob der Code funktioniert, wenn es in Google erscheinen wird, wie man andere Informationen, etc, etc, etc. Also lasst uns dort hingehen

– Woher weiß ich, welche Datei soll ich in Magento ändern?

Ich habe das Magento Debug, wie in diesem Beitrag gezeigt: Welche Datei zu ändern?

– Wie kann ich wissen, welche Markup-Tags in RDFa verfügbar sind?

Zur Unterstützung von Google Webmasters gibt es eine Liste von ihnen: Rich snippets – Review ratings

– Wie teste ich? Ich möchte wissen, ob der Code korrekt ist.

Es gibt ein Tool in Google Webmaster, wo Sie die URL Ihrer Website eingeben können, oder kopieren / fügen Sie den generierten HTML-Code, um das Ergebnis (und mögliche Fehler) zu sehen: http://www.google.com/webmasters/tools/richsnippets

– Wann wird dieses Ergebnis auf Google erscheinen?

Ich weiß nicht, ich arbeite nicht bei Google. Aber wahrscheinlich, sobald Ihr Code indiziert und von Suchmaschinen validiert wird. Dies kann Stunden, Tage oder sogar Wochen dauern.

Erfolg!